    Stage 3 impressions, SRM review.

    Guest-only advertisement. Register or Log In now!
    Tonight I finally got my S6 back together and went for a 30 mile shake down drive. I went with EPL for the stage 3 beta tune and SRM for replacement turbos, inlets and downpipes. Not installed yet is a merc racing quad pass heat exchanger and "the pump mod" Sean at SRM is great to deal with, always got back to me or answered my calls or messages. The beta file from EPL is a dramatic improvement over the stage 2 tune I had previously. Anyone with blown up turbos before you give your money to Audi, check out the replacements available at a fraction of the cost at SRM. If you are doing the work yourself you can do a stage 3 build now right around 5k if you do it right and depending on what you already have. Thanks to the community for all the help on here.

    Quote Originally Posted by [waZZup] View Post
    Imagine how it affects flex pipe life. If it prevents heat from being dissipated from downpipes, it mens almost all the heat is passed to the further exhaust components which are (probably) not designed to handle so much. Couldn't it damage them?
    Not sure how it would affect overall exhaust life, but I had my catless dp's on my 2.7TT wrapped for many years which endured all sorts of driving (couple track days, long road trips, weather) and had zero issues throughout the years, for me anyways. I've heard non stainless pipes can oxidize and rot a lot quicker which makes sense, especially if the wrap is getting wet a lot. The drastically reduced engine bay temps were fantastic though, and I'm sure really helped with components longevity.

    Quote Originally Posted by s4nicetry View Post
    Quick question but did EPL remove the O2 inefficiency codes for the stg.3 tune or are you still getting a CEL? Any fitment issues with those dp's?
    I have spacers made by vibrant with the smallest insert. I'm not getting a cel. But they didnt remove that or the speed limiter as fas as I know. That limits me on half mile events and top speed roll racing events. Maybe look into taking that out @chris@epl and @tony@epl ?

    As far as the downpipes, they are beautiful, but there is no way in hell they are mating to my stock catback. If you had an S8 I'd say maybe. Mine ended up needing 7 inches taken out. Thankfully I have a band saw and TIG welder at my disposal so I was able to make it look like it never happened. I have a feeling I got a set for an S8 honestly. If I cut the factory catback I would have been clamping right on one of the bends and it would never have worked.
